Hyderabad: The 5th Telangana Bengali Film Festival ‘Aanya-2022’ kicks off today in Hyderabad. It will open today at 6.30pm at the Prasad Preview Theater in Hyderabad. The three-day event will conclude on Sunday, December 11th.
This is a great opportunity for Bengali moving lovers away from home to attend a film festival and watch movies in Bengali. The festival is jointly organized by Hyderabad Bangalee Samiti and Telangana Department of Tourism.
The three-day event will screen eight Bengali-language films and five short films, two Telugu-language films and one Odia-language film.
‘Jayamma Panchayathi’ and ‘Virata Parvam’ are two Telugu films that will be screened during the event on December 9th and 10th at 6pm respectively.
“Avijatrik” directed by Subhrajit Mitra will be the opening film of the 5th Telangana Bengali Film Festival.
Bengali actors such as Arindam Sil, Bibriti Chatterjee, Tathagata Mukherjee, Bibriti Chatterjee, Rafiath Rashid Mithila, Gargee Roy Chowdhury and Rabanti Chatterjee will grace today’s event.
Admission is free, and Bangladeshi movie fans can get free movie tickets by scanning the QR code displayed at the venue. Hyderabad Bangalee Samiti is a Bangladeshi socio-cultural organization that has been doing charitable activities in Hyderabad for the past 79 years.
